This November, Miano Academy welcomes fine artist Qiang Huang for a Master Workshop on painting still life’s in oil.
Since his youth in Beijing, China, Huang has carried the heart of an artist. Though his professional life saw him obtaining a Ph. D. in physics and working in optical engineering, he never let go of his passion for art, remaining active in the creative community. Pursuing a formal artistic education later in life, he studied under artists such as David Leffel, Scott Burdick, and Zhoaming Wu. His artistic prowess has been widely recognized, with his paintings featured internationally in both galleries and print.
Through the years of honing his bold signature style, Huang found he was also skilled in helping others along their artistic journeys. Since 2008 he has guided workshops on painting striking still life’s in oil, helping aspiring artists gain mastery and build confidence. A friendly, approachable mentor, he imparts both technical knowledge, alongside wisdom from his personal experiences.
During this multi-day workshop, Huang will share his alla prima -or direct approach- to fine art. Watch -and learn- how he masterfully uses bright, spontaneous color and expressive brushstrokes to create vivid, dynamic fine art, before practicing on your own.
